Orange County's coastline epitomizes the world famous California beach lifestyle. Stretching from Long Beach down to San Diego County to the south, there is plenty of surf and sand for everyone. Married to a native Southern California Surfer Guy, I have learned my way around our beaches. Now that I have kids, I've grown to appreciate amenities and kid friendly aspects at some of the beaches in the OC. Here are my top picks for families:

North Beach

1725 Avenida Estacion
San Clemente, CA 92672

North Beach's parking allows you to pull right up to the sand, unload and have everyone settled on the sand in mere minutes. The occasional trains running on the nearby tracks add an additional piece of entertainment for the youngsters. Amenities include: playground, nice restrooms, showers, fire rings, picnic tables and snack bars during the summer months.

Aliso Beach

31131 S Pacific Coast Hwy
Laguna Beach, CA 92651

Metered public parking convenient to the beach, clean restrooms, showers, fire rings and a playground make Aliso Beach a family favorite. There is a café that sells a wide variety of food and beverages. You are also conveniently located close to downtown Laguna Beach's restaurants and shops.

Seal Beach

Main Street & Ocean Ave
Seal Beach, CA 90740

Aim for the pier at Seal Beach where you'll find a walled in playground that is perfect to contain the younger kids. Older kids will have fun checking out the fishermen on the pier. There are shops and restaurants along Main St. and a Ruby's Diner at the end of the pier. Beachgoers love that this beach is rarely crowded and parking is only $5.

Huntington City Beach

400 Pacific Coast Hwy
Huntington Beach, CA 92648

When you envision the California "Surf City" beach experience, Huntington Beach is where it's at. City Beach covers 3.5 miles on either side of the pier and provides easy access to the heart of downtown right across Pacific Coast Highway. Plenty of metered parking, food, restrooms and showers make this a family friendly stretch of sand. Canine family members are welcome at the adjacent "Dog Beach" one of the few dog friendly beaches in California.

Little Corona del Mar Beach

Pacific Coast Highway & Poppy Ave.
Corona del Mar, CA 92625

For the future marine biologists, consider a visit to this beach famous for its tidepools. Kids can spend hours checking out ocean life such as anemones, starfish and hermit crabs. Make sure you have appropriate footwear for sharp rocks. There is plenty of free parking on the residential streets, otherwise it's $15 in the lot.
